Plant growth regulators Plant growth regulators are pesticides that have stringent requirements in terms of use, such as the period of use, amount, and method of use. Must be used according to the instructions, otherwise it will have adverse consequences. The effects of plant growth regulators are generally obvious and stable, and are less affected by environmental conditions, so they are popularized and applied quickly and are easily accepted by users. It is a synthetic organic compound with plant natural hormone activity. According to its different regulation effects on crops, it can be divided into two categories: (1) growth-promoting, such as 920, 802, ethephon, etc.; (2) growth control, such as paclobutrazol, chlormequat, ketamine and the like.
Plant growth agents Plant growth agents are fertilizers, also known as plant nutrients, plant complex liquid fertilizers, and the like. It is a kind of nutrient which is made by combining a large amount of nitrogen, phosphorus, potassium, iron, zinc, manganese, boron, copper and other trace elements. Most of the crop roots absorb leaf water and make leaf surface fertilizer to supplement nutrients. Promote crop growth and development. Although plant growth agents have good effects on crops, they are highly selective in terms of environmental conditions, crop growth, and field management, and their effects are very unstable. Attention should be paid when using them.
SMD LED means surface mount Light Emitting Diode, SMD chip helps to improve production efficiency, as well as application in different facilities. It is a solid-state semiconductor device that can directly convert electricity into light. Its voltage is 1.9-3.2V, the red light and yellow light voltage are the lowest. The heart of the LED is a semiconductor chip. Encapsulated with epoxy resin. The semiconductor wafer is composed of two parts, one part is a P-type semiconductor, in which holes dominate, and the other end is an N-type semiconductor, which is mainly electrons. But when these two semiconductors are connected, a P-N junction is formed between them. When the current acts on the chip through the wire, the electrons will be pushed to the P area, where the electrons and holes recombine, and then emit energy in the form of photons. This is the principle of LED light emission. The wavelength of light is also the color of light, which is determined by the material forming the P-N junction.
